Every time you lift something, remember to bend your knees first, this will prevent your lower back from getting tense causing damage to your spine and back muscles. Never twist while lifting this can have bad effect on your vertebrates. Avoid lifting heavy objects Do not sit in couches, always sit in firm chairs supporting the lumbar area with a pillow. This will help you keep your waist and lower back in the proper position. Apply St. John’s wort directly to the back area. CAUTION: Do not suntan, this oil makes your skin very sensitive to the sun.
